Day 2: Discovering History and Culture

Kick off your second day in Millsboro with a visit to the Nanticoke Indian Museum. Immerse yourself in the rich Native American heritage of the Nanticoke Tribe as you explore fascinating exhibits showcasing traditional artifacts, artwork, and historical documents. Engage with knowledgeable guides who will share captivating stories and traditions passed down through generations.

Day 3: Embracing Outdoor Adventures

On your final day in Millsboro, embark on an exciting adventure at Trap Pond State Park. Known for its impressive cypress swamp and diverse wildlife, this park offers endless opportunities for outdoor enthusiasts. Rent a canoe or kayak and paddle through the peaceful waters, surrounded by towering trees and the sounds of nature. Keep an eye out for the park’s famous inhabitants, such as the elusive bald cypress and the charming eastern box turtle.
